### 3.0.6
- Fixed [#809](https://github.com/actions/cache/issues/809) - zstd -d: no such file or directory error
- Fixed [#833](https://github.com/actions/cache/issues/833) - cache doesn't work with github workspace directory
- Fixed [#833](https://github.com/actions/cache/issues/833) - cache doesn't work with github workspace directory

### 3.0.7
- Fixed [#810](https://github.com/actions/cache/issues/810) - download stuck issue. A new timeout is introduced in the download process to abort the download if it gets stuck and doesn't finish within an hour.
33 changes: 29 additions & 4 deletions dist/restore/index.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-5473,6 +5473,7 @@ const util = __importStar(__webpack_require__(669));
const utils = __importStar(__webpack_require__(15));
const constants_1 = __webpack_require__(931);
const requestUtils_1 = __webpack_require__(899);
const abort_controller_1 = __webpack_require__(106);
/**
* Pipes the body of a HTTP response to a stream
*
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-5656,15 +5657,24 @@ function downloadCacheStorageSDK(archiveLocation, archivePath, options) {
const fd = fs.openSync(archivePath, 'w');
try {
downloadProgress.startDisplayTimer();
const controller = new abort_controller_1.AbortController();
const abortSignal = controller.signal;
while (!downloadProgress.isDone()) {
const segmentStart = downloadProgress.segmentOffset + downloadProgress.segmentSize;
const segmentSize = Math.min(maxSegmentSize, contentLength - segmentStart);
downloadProgress.nextSegment(segmentSize);
const result = yield client.downloadToBuffer(segmentStart, segmentSize, {
const result = yield promiseWithTimeout(options.segmentTimeoutInMs || 3600000, client.downloadToBuffer(segmentStart, segmentSize, {
abortSignal,
concurrency: options.downloadConcurrency,
onProgress: downloadProgress.onProgress()
});
fs.writeFileSync(fd, result);
}));
if (result === 'timeout') {
controller.abort();
throw new Error('Aborting cache download as the download time exceeded the timeout.');
}
else if (Buffer.isBuffer(result)) {
fs.writeFileSync(fd, result);
}
}
}
finally {
Expand All @@ -5675,6 +5685,16 @@ function downloadCacheStorageSDK(archiveLocation, archivePath, options) {
});
}
exports.downloadCacheStorageSDK = downloadCacheStorageSDK;
const promiseWithTimeout = (timeoutMs, promise) => __awaiter(void 0, void 0, void 0, function* () {
let timeoutHandle;
const timeoutPromise = new Promise(resolve => {
timeoutHandle = setTimeout(() => resolve('timeout'), timeoutMs);
});
return Promise.race([promise, timeoutPromise]).then(result => {
clearTimeout(timeoutHandle);
return result;
});
});
//# sourceMappingURL=downloadUtils.js.map

/***/ }),
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-40795,7 +40815,8 @@ function getDownloadOptions(copy) {
const result = {
useAzureSdk: true,
downloadConcurrency: 8,
timeoutInMs: 30000
timeoutInMs: 30000,
segmentTimeoutInMs: 3600000
};
if (copy) {
if (typeof copy.useAzureSdk === 'boolean') {
Expand All @@ -40807,10 +40828,14 @@ function getDownloadOptions(copy) {
if (typeof copy.timeoutInMs === 'number') {
result.timeoutInMs = copy.timeoutInMs;
}
if (typeof copy.segmentTimeoutInMs === 'number') {
result.segmentTimeoutInMs = copy.segmentTimeoutInMs;
}
}
core.debug(`Use Azure SDK: ${result.useAzureSdk}`);
core.debug(`Download concurrency: ${result.downloadConcurrency}`);
core.debug(`Request timeout (ms): ${result.timeoutInMs}`);
core.debug(`Segment download timeout (ms): ${result.segmentTimeoutInMs}`);
return result;
}
exports.getDownloadOptions = getDownloadOptions;
